Chausson's lovely Poéme for Violin and Orchestra, a lush late-nineteenth-century symphonic poem for violin and orchestra, and Schubert's Rondo in A major, another single concerted movement but from the first part of that century, make perfect companion pieces. Filled with luscious 19th-century themes but given the very different treatments typical of each composer and also of their very different musical eras. Both are marvelous concert-pieces.
The sheet music comes with CD recordings of the work, one version with the solo part and accompaniment, and one with just the accompaniment for you to play along to. Geoffrey Applegate is the violin soloist with the Stuttgart Symphony Orchestra conducted by Emil Kahn.
